Hello,
Most often such symptoms are due to viral infections and antibiotics are ineffective in such cases and so I would advise against giving Taxim-O or Azithral without checking the blood counts. Antibiotics would not help and irrespective of antibiotics, it usually spontaneously resolves in 5-7 days. You can give her Relent or Allegra along with Brozeet. Meftal needs to be given only if there is fever.
You need to give steam inhalation to your child. It helps in reducing the congestion. Water vapor will reach deep inside and would help in diluting the cough and thus would provide relief. Use Nasoclear Saline Nasal Drops in case of nose block.
